What Is Shilajit and Why Testing Matters?
Shilajit is a natural mineral resin formed over centuries in high-altitude mountain rocks, especially in the Himalayas. It contains organic compounds, trace minerals, and fulvic acid.
However, raw or untested Shilajit may contain:
- Heavy metals
- Soil impurities
- Microbial contamination
Moreover, without proper purification and testing, these contaminants may remain in the final product. Therefore, lab testing ensures that only safe and beneficial compounds are consumed.
In addition, testing confirms whether the product is genuine Himalayan resin or a diluted imitation.
What Does Lab Testing of Shilajit Include?
Lab testing of Shilajit covers several scientific checks that ensure safety and quality.
Heavy Metal Testing
Laboratories test for harmful elements such as:
- Lead
- Mercury
- Arsenic
- Cadmium
Moreover, acceptable limits must comply with international safety standards.
Microbial Testing
This process checks for:
- Bacteria
- Fungi
- Mold
Therefore, it ensures the product is safe for consumption.
Fulvic Acid Analysis
Fulvic acid is one of the most important compounds in Shilajit. Lab testing measures its concentration because higher levels often indicate better quality.
In addition, fulvic acid supports nutrient transport in the body.
Mineral Profile Verification
Shilajit contains trace minerals like:
- Iron
- Magnesium
- Zinc
- Potassium
Testing confirms whether these minerals exist in natural balance.
How to Read a Shilajit Lab Test Report
A lab report, also known as a Certificate of Analysis (COA), provides detailed information about product quality.
First, check the heavy metal section to ensure all values are within safe limits. Then, review fulvic acid percentage to confirm potency.
Moreover, a reliable COA should include:
- Batch number
- Testing date
- Laboratory name
- Detailed chemical breakdown
In addition, reputable brands provide third-party verification instead of internal testing only.
Therefore, transparency in reporting indicates product trustworthiness.
